/**
 * Settings class to configure an instance of {@link OrgPolicyStub}.
 *
 * <p>The default instance has everything set to sensible defaults:
 *
 * <ul>
 *   <li>The default service address (orgpolicy.googleapis.com) and default port (443) are used.
 *   <li>Credentials are acquired automatically through Application Default Credentials.
 *   <li>Retries are configured for idempotent methods but not for non-idempotent methods.
 * </ul>
 *
 * <p>The builder of this class is recursive, so contained classes are themselves builders. When
 * build() is called, the tree of builders is called to create the complete settings object.
 *
 * <p>For example, to set the total timeout of getPolicy to 30 seconds:
 *
 * <pre>{@code
 * // This snippet has been automatically generated and should be regarded as a code template only.
 * // It will require modifications to work:
 * // - It may require correct/in-range values for request initialization.
 * // - It may require specifying regional endpoints when creating the service client as shown in
 * // https://cloud.google.com/java/docs/setup#configure_endpoints_for_the_client_library
 * OrgPolicyStubSettings.Builder orgPolicySettingsBuilder = OrgPolicyStubSettings.newBuilder();
 * orgPolicySettingsBuilder
 *     .getPolicySettings()
 *     .setRetrySettings(
 *         orgPolicySettingsBuilder.getPolicySettings().getRetrySettings().toBuilder()
 *             .setTotalTimeout(Duration.ofSeconds(30))
 *             .build());
 * OrgPolicyStubSettings orgPolicySettings = orgPolicySettingsBuilder.build();
 * }</pre>
 */
